One of the great resources for runners in Norway is the Kondis organisation, who both publish magazine 9 times a year (incl. summer and winter race calendar) and run an active online website at www.kondis.no.
Here you can get inspirational content to help develop your running and read about the latest things in running, whether that’s training tips, shoes, athlete profiles or reports from small local races around the country.
They have been supporters of parkrun from the start and have regularly featured profiles of our events on their website and social media. Not only that, but they have helped to measure our existing parkruns with the help of a measuring wheel, to ensure that our events are held over an accurate 5km.
